In the age of digital transformation, security protocols like CAPTCHA (Completely Automated Public Turing test to tell Computers and Humans Apart) have become common tools to protect websites from automated bots and malicious activity. However, many users who require bulk data extraction, web scraping, or other automated activities may find CAPTCHAs to be a significant obstacle. One effective solution to bypass CAPTCHA protection is by using proxy ip addresses. Proxies mask your real IP address and can help simulate human-like activity, making it easier to evade CAPTCHAs. In this article, we will explore how proxy ips can be used to navigate around CAPTCHA protection mechanisms, the techniques involved, and the considerations to keep in mind.
Before diving into the bypass methods, it is essential to understand what CAPTCHA is and why it is so widely used. CAPTCHA systems are designed to prevent automated bots from interacting with websites. They typically ask users to complete a challenge that is simple for humans but difficult for bots. Common challenges include identifying distorted text, solving puzzles, or recognizing images based on certain criteria. The purpose of CAPTCHA is to filter out non-human traffic, ensuring that only legitimate users can access a website's features or services.
For businesses and individuals involved in web scraping or data collection, CAPTCHAs present a significant hurdle, as they require real human intervention to solve. This leads to the need for a method to bypass CAPTCHA systems to carry out automated tasks efficiently.
The primary role of proxies in bypassing CAPTCHA mechanisms is to alter the apparent source of traffic. When a bot or automated script attempts to scrape data from a website, CAPTCHA systems analyze patterns that seem artificial or non-human. These patterns include rapid requests from a single IP address or a high frequency of similar actions that don’t mimic typical human behavior.
Proxies function by masking the original IP address and substituting it with a different one. By rotating proxies or using large pools of IP addresses, automated systems can distribute their requests across various IPs, making the traffic appear less suspicious and human-like. Here are some of the techniques that involve using proxy IPs to bypass CAPTCHA:
One of the most common methods for evading CAPTCHA challenges is the use of rotating proxy networks. These networks consist of a large number of IP addresses, often spread across multiple geographical locations. By rotating through these IP addresses, automated systems can make requests that resemble legitimate, human-like traffic. The continuous rotation helps avoid triggering CAPTCHA tests, as each request originates from a different IP address. This makes it challenging for CAPTCHA systems to detect patterns indicative of automated behavior.
Another effective method involves using residential proxies. These proxies are IP addresses assigned to real devices, such as home routers, which makes them appear as legitimate, human traffic. Since residential IPs are harder for CAPTCHA systems to distinguish from regular user traffic, they are less likely to trigger CAPTCHA challenges. Residential proxies can be particularly useful when targeting specific regions or countries, as they can make requests from IP addresses that are geographically relevant to the target website.
While proxies mask the IP address, session control and cookie management also play a significant role in bypassing CAPTCHA systems. When using proxies, maintaining a session across requests can help avoid triggering CAPTCHA. This involves managing cookies that are sent along with each request to preserve session data, such as login status or user preferences. By simulating a persistent session, it becomes more difficult for CAPTCHA systems to detect automated activity.
Bots often trigger CAPTCHAs because they make requests at unnaturally high frequencies or patterns. To bypass CAPTCHA protection, it is essential to mimic human-like behavior. Proxy networks with intelligent traffic routing can help distribute requests at randomized intervals, ensuring that they are not made in a consistent or predictable pattern. By timing requests in a way that aligns with human behavior, the risk of triggering CAPTCHA tests is minimized.
In some cases, proxy IPs alone may not be enough to bypass CAPTCHA systems. This is where CAPTCHA solving services come into play. These services utilize real humans or advanced algorithms to solve CAPTCHA challenges quickly and accurately. By combining proxies with CAPTCHA-solving services, users can effectively bypass CAPTCHA protection and complete their automated tasks without interruption.
While using proxy IPs to bypass CAPTCHA protection can be effective, there are several important considerations to keep in mind:
Before engaging in activities that involve bypassing CAPTCHA systems, it is crucial to consider the ethical and legal implications. Many websites deploy CAPTCHA protection to safeguard their data and prevent abuse. Circumventing these protections could violate a website’s terms of service, and in some cases, it may even be considered illegal. It is important to ensure that your use of proxies and CAPTCHA bypass methods aligns with applicable laws and the website’s policies.
To maximize the effectiveness of proxies in bypassing CAPTCHA, it is important to avoid detection. This can be challenging, as CAPTCHA systems are continuously evolving to detect more sophisticated methods of evasion. Using a diverse range of proxies, rotating IPs regularly, and mimicking human-like behavior can help reduce the chances of detection. However, it is always a good idea to monitor your traffic patterns to ensure that you are not triggering anti-bot mechanisms.
When using proxies, it is important to respect rate limiting to avoid overwhelming the target website’s servers. Making too many requests in a short period of time can lead to IP bans or CAPTCHA challenges. By spreading out requests and ensuring they follow natural intervals, you can reduce the likelihood of encountering CAPTCHA systems and avoid causing disruption to the website’s normal operations.
Not all proxy networks are created equal. The quality of proxies used for bypassing CAPTCHA is paramount. High-quality proxies, such as residential IPs and private proxy pools, provide better anonymity and lower the chances of detection. Using low-quality proxies or public proxy lists can increase the risk of being flagged by CAPTCHA systems and lead to ineffective results.
Bypassing CAPTCHA protection with the use of proxy IPs is a valuable technique for those who need to carry out automated activities like web scraping or data extraction. By rotating proxies, using residential IPs, and managing session data effectively, users can reduce the likelihood of triggering CAPTCHA systems and continue their operations without interruptions. However, it is crucial to consider the ethical and legal implications, ensure proxy quality, and adopt strategies to avoid detection. By understanding how CAPTCHA systems work and implementing the right techniques, users can successfully navigate the challenges posed by CAPTCHA protections.